Renault is hoping a free breakdown cover offer will help it retain customers when their cars come out of warranty.

The Four For Free offer is an extension of the carmaker’s existing three-year Renault Assistance plan, provided in conjunction with the AA to buyers of new Renaults. Now customers with a Renault aged between three and seven years, which is MoT’d at a participating dealer in the franchise network, will receive an additional year of roadside assistance without an additional charge.

“Four For Free is a response to increased service capacity within the Renault network which now has the ability to cope with increased service volumes and will see Renault focus on service marketing and improved aftersales loyalty,” says a spokesman.

Renault is asking interested customers to register via its website and customer service line, after which it will send them a voucher with details of their nearest participating dealer.

The cover includes 24-hour breakdown assistance, home-start assistance and recovery within 10 miles to the nearest Renault dealer.
